Slow Cooker Hearty Potato Bacon Chowder
Servings: 6-8
Ingredients
6 slices of bacon, diced
1 medium onion, chopped
3 garlic cloves, minced
5-6 large potatoes, peeled and cubed
4 cups chicken broth
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 cup heavy cream
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
